create-chat-sdk でチャットアプリをスキャフォールドする
Vercel は、Next.js プロジェクトを基盤としたチャットボット開発の初期設定を単一コマンドで自動化する CLI ツール「create-chat-sdk」を発表し、開発者の生産性を大幅に向上させた。
キーポイント
ワンコマンドでのプロジェクト生成
プラットフォームアダプター(Slack, Discord など)と状態管理アダプター(Redis など)を選択するだけで、依存関係のインストールから環境変数の設定まで完了する Next.js プロジェクトを即座に構築できる。
完全なスクリプト対応と CI 統合
すべてのプロンプトをフラグでスキップ可能であり、AI エージェントや CI/CD パイプライン内での非対話型実行をサポートし、自動化ワークフローにシームレスに組み込める。
柔軟なスタックの組み合わせ
公式およびベンダー公式のアダプターを自由に組み合わせることができ、CLI は選択されたコンポーネントのみをインストールするため、プロジェクトの軽量化と最適化が可能である。
影響分析・編集コメントを表示
影響分析
このツールは、チャットボット開発における「環境構築の壁」を解消し、開発者がロジックや AI ロールアウトに集中できる環境を提供します。特に Next.js ユーザーにとって、マルチプラットフォーム対応ボットの立ち上げハードルが下がることで、AI アプリケーションの実装スピードが加速すると期待されます。
編集コメント
開発環境の構築コストを極限まで下げるこのアプローチは、AI アプリケーションの迅速なプロトタイピングにおいて非常に価値が高いです。
新しい Chat SDK ボットを作成するには、単一のコマンドを実行するだけで済むようになりました。
create-chat-sdk は、選択したプラットフォームアダプター、状態管理アダプター、環境変数、および Webhook ルートを含む完全な Next.js プロジェクトをスキャフォールドします。
この CLI は、プラットフォームアダプター(例:Slack と Discord)と状態管理アダプター(例:Redis)の選択をガイドし、必要な依存関係を自動的にインストールします。
すべての接続が完了しています:onNewMention および onSubscribedMessage ハンドラーを含む src/lib/bot.ts、設定済みの .env.example、および事前構成された next.config.ts です。
スタックを選択してください:公式またはベンダー公式のプラットフォームアダプターと状態管理アダプターを自由に組み合わせて単一プロジェクトに統合できます。CLI は選択した要素のみをインストールします。
フルスクリプト対応:すべてのプロンプトはフラグでスキップ可能であるため、create-chat-sdk は AI エージェントや CI 環境でも動作します。コーディングエージェントが自動的に検出されるため、アプリケーションのスキャフォールディング時には CLI が非対話モードで実行されます。
例えば、Slack と Discord のボットを Redis を使用して単一コマンドでスキャフォールドするには:
ドキュメントを読んで始めましょう。
続きを読む
原文を表示
Creating a new Chat SDK bot now takes a single command.
create-chat-sdk scaffolds a complete Next.js project with your chosen platform adapters, a state adapter, environment variables, and a webhook route.
The CLI walks you through selecting your platform adapters (e.g., Slack and Discord) and a state adapter (e.g., Redis), then installs the dependencies for you.
Everything wired up: src/lib/bot.ts with onNewMention and onSubscribedMessage handlers, a populated .env.example, and a pre-configured next.config.ts.
Pick your stack: combine any of the official or vendor-official platform and state adapters into a single project. The CLI installs only what you select.
Fully scriptable: every prompt can be skipped with flags, so create-chat-sdk works with your AI agents and in CI. Coding agents are automatically detected, so the CLI runs non-interactively when they scaffold your application.
For example, scaffold a Slack and Discord bot with Redis in one command:
Read the documentation to get started.
Read more
関連記事
今日のまとめ
AI日報で今日の重要ニュースをまとめ読み